Official Description (provided by the hotel):
Fully restored Cape Cod style home located in the historic district of Yarmouth Port. Conveniently located to fine dining, beaches, ferries, whale watching, nature trails. The inn has 5 tastefully decorated guest rooms with AC and private bath. A full breakfast is served daily consisting of fresh baked goods, fresh fruit, main course, freshly ground coffee and assorted teas. ... more   less
